Considerable effort has recently been devoted to augmenting existing spreadsheet capabilities with the power of mathematical programming. One way to accomplish this is to design mathematical programming‐based solution methodologies (most likely heuristics) that exploit existing spreadsheet capabilities. We describe how this latter approach was successfully applied to an integer programming model of an international telecommunications network.
